Skoda launches the all-new Kodiaq in Singapore

With its stylish design and incredible practicality, the Skoda Kodiaq has managed to become one of the brand's top-selling models, ranking third within its entire lineup.
Today, the all-new Kodiaq has been officially unveiled in Singapore, growing in size to offer more space, along with a host of new features and impressive equipment as standard.
Upon the initial glance, those unfamiliar might mistake the all-new Kodiaq for a facelift. However, it is actually an entirely new car that is now build upon the Volkswagen Group MQB Evo platform - the same one that underpins the current Octavia.
The Kodiaq has grown by 61mm in length - all of which can be found at the rear overhang area, increasing the boot space from 270 litres to 340 litres with all seats up. This expands to 845 litres with the third row down, and to a maximum of 2,035 litres with all seats folded. The car is also 2mm lower than before, which in tandem with the lengthened body, results in a leaner silhouette.

Up front, the Kodiaq retains its iconic 'four-eyed' head light design, now with Skoda's second-generation LED Matrix beam head lights as standard. This trick pair of head lights is a powerhouse that consists of a Matrix Beam module with 36 pixels, a Bi-LED module, side light and all-weather light, along with a daytime running light that doubles as a direction indicator.

Flanked by the head lights is a large octagonal grille with a horizontal light strip that is broken up by the slats within, creating a unique light signature. The front bumper features a wide continuous air intake with honeycomb structure along with functional side vents.

Look past the front end and the sculpted body of the Kodiaq with a stylishly tapered roofline will lead you to the rear-end that features a striking pair of taillights with 3D crystalline structure within.
Head inside the new Kodiaq and you'll be greeted by a spacious and fresh interior, headlined by a brand-new 13.0-inch infotainment system that features w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to.

Designed with user experience in mind, the infotainment system has a new menu structure with an array of customisable shortcuts to allow quick access to features that you frequent.
Below the large display are the new smart dials with integrated digital displays - a quick press on the centre of the dial allows you to toggle between various functions that could be adjusted by rotating the knob surrounding the display. Head further south and you'll find two wireless charging trays with active cooling.

The driver will also enjoy the convenience of an electrically adjustable driver seat with memory function, along with a complete suite of driver assist systems, including Adaptive Cruise Control, Front Assist with braking reaction to vehicles, pedestrians and cyclists, Lane Assist and Side Assist, to ensure a relaxing and safe drive.
The spacious cabin of the Kodiaq will allow you to transport up to six passengers in comfort with a good amount of legroom and headroom.
The all-new Skoda Kodiaq will be offered in its sole Selection trim, powered by an updated 1.5-litre four-cylinder turbocharged TSI engine that produces 148bhp and 250Nm of torque, all of which are sent through a seven-speed DSG transmission, to the front wheels.
Car model | Price as of press time (including COE) |
Skoda Kodiaq 1.5 TSI Selection (A) | $222,900 |
